Our "New" New Years Tradition

Last year we did something as a family that we enjoyed so much, that we decided to make it a tradition! At the beginning of 2009, we sat down as a family and wrote out our predictions for what we thought would happen with our family before 2010. Then, during Christmastime, we sat down and got out that paper and read our predictions. It was an amazing, funny thing to read. I know that these pieces of paper will be treasured for many years to come. I think I will highlight all of the predictions that actually came true. I was so surprised at how many of mine actually happened in 2009.
